The Advantages of Using Wooden Pallets1. Strength and Durability
Wooden pallets are renowned for their remarkable strength, making them appropriate for transferring heavy loads. Constructed from difficult or softwoods, these pallets can stand up to the rigors of transport, stacking, and handling.

Table 1: Strength Comparison of Different Pallet Materials
Material TypeLoad Capacity (lbs)Typical UsesWooden Pallets1,500 - 4,000Heavy goods, machineryPlastic Pallets1,000 - 3,000Food, pharmaceuticalsMetal Pallets2,000 - 5,000Industrial and outdoor usage2. Cost-Effectiveness
Wooden pallets are normally less costly than their plastic or metal equivalents. They are readily offered and can be reused several times, making them a cost-effective choice for businesses.
3. Eco-Friendly Option
As the world significantly concentrates on sustainability, wooden pallets shine with their eco-friendliness. Sourced from renewable resources, wooden pallets are eco-friendly and can be recycled into other wood items once they reach the end of their helpful life.
4. Customization
Wooden pallets can be easily customized to satisfy particular measurements and tolerances. This adaptability improves their usability for different items and applications in various markets.
5. Easily Repairable
Among the most significant benefits of wooden pallets is their reparability. Damaged pallets can frequently be repaired utilizing basic tools, decreasing waste and keeping cost efficiency for companies.
Types of Wooden Pallets
There are 2 main types of wooden pallets used in shipping:
1. Block PalletsDescription: These pallets include blocks for improved stability and strength.Advantages: They can be raised from all four sides, making them versatile for different forklifts and pallet jacks.2. Stringer PalletsDescription: Stringer pallets are comprised of boards or stringers that offer support by linking the top and bottom decks.Benefits: They are often lighter and more economical, however less robust compared to block pallets.Table 2: Comparison of Block and Stringer PalletsFunctionBlock PalletsStringer PalletsRaising DirectionAll 4 sidesTwo sides justWeightHeavier (more durable)Lighter (more economical)RepairabilityModerateMuch easierApplicationsHeavy loads/industrial usageGeneral utilizeBest Practices for Shipping with Wooden Pallets1. Appropriate Loading Techniques
To maximize the energy of wooden pallets, it is crucial to disperse the weight uniformly across the pallet. Avoid overloading, which can result in damage.
2. Routine Inspections
Checking wooden pallets routinely for indications of damage guarantees safety in carrying products. Search for cracks, split boards, and extreme wear.
3. Choosing the Right Type
Depending upon the weight and type of items being transported, employing the appropriate kind of pallet (block vs. stringer) is vital to enhance security and effectiveness.
4. Adequate Storage
Store wooden pallets in a dry location to prevent the deterioration of wood due to wetness, which can result in mold or warping.
Frequently asked question SectionQ1: Are wooden pallets safe for food transport?
A1: Yes, wooden pallets can be safe for food transportation. Nevertheless, it's vital to use heat-treated pallets that reduce the risk of contamination and comply with food safety standards.
Q2: How numerous times can a wooden pallet be reused?
A2: The life expectancy of a wooden pallet can vary from 5 to 15 trips, depending upon its construction quality and the care it receives during use.
Q3: What is heat treatment worrying wooden pallets?
A3: Heat treatment is a procedure that involves heating the pallets to a particular temperature to exterminate insects and pathogens, making them safe for worldwide shipping based on ISPM 15 guidelines.
Q4: Can wooden pallets be recycled?
A4: Yes, wooden pallets can be quickly recycled into mulch or re-manufactured into new pallets or wood-based products, adding to a circular economy.
Q5: What are the alternatives to wooden pallets?
A5: Alternatives consist of plastic and metal pallets. While they do offer particular advantages such as boosted cleanliness and longevity, they typically feature greater costs and ecological considerations.
